14-11 Bears will join students in lessons for Pudsey

Some unfamiliar faces will be popping up at Corby Technical School tomorrow in aid of Children In Need.

Students and staff will be bringing along their favourite furry friends as part of Bring a Bear day.
In exchange for the chance to take their teddy bears to school for the day students and staff will be asked for a suggested donation of £1. All the money raised will go towards Children in Need and the Philippines disaster appeal.
CTS principal Angela Reynolds said: “Everyone can bring a small bear with them to school but the bears have been told they have to behave.
“We ran this fundraiser last year and it was really popular with the students. It’s a great way to raise money.”
